Orcas communicate using a series of clicks, whistles, and pulsed calls, each sound conveying specific information. Scientists liken these sounds to a language, one that is still largely a mystery to humans. Recent studies are revealing just how intelligent and emotionally complex orcas are, throwing previous misconceptions about this apex predator into the water. Orca have been observed to engage in behaviors previously exclusive to primates, such as using tools and teaching other members of the pod. These insights have broadened our understanding of orca cognition and social organization and, indeed, of orca importance as a keystone species in marine ecosystems. An interesting fact: did you know that orcas are matriarchal? In their pods it’s the females that lead, passing on information and tradition to younger generations. Now, let’s dig a bit into the cultural impact of orcas, a creature whose imagery has permeated human history across cultures. From the art of indigenous peoples in the Pacific Northwest to ancient Scandinavian sagas, orcas have long been symbols of strength, intelligence, and community.
